In what is an after Christmas/beginning of the New Year tradition, the Giant L.A. RV Show rolls into Fairplex Dec. 26 through Jan. 8. The show is a virtual one-stop shopping experience – offering the coaches, financing and even driving lessons in one location. The show will be in the White Avenue lot at Gate 9. Hours are 9 a.m. to 6 p.m. daily. There is no charge for admission.
Sales and accessories of recreational vehicles is a $14 billion industry. The number of RV-owning households in the United States is projected to rise to nearly 8.5 million by 2010, according to a study by the University of Michigan. Baby boomers are driving the increase in RV popularity, says the Recreational Vehicle Industry Association. RV ownership now spans a 40-year age range from 35 to 75, with boomers between the ages of 55 to 64 having the highest ownership.
Giant RV, one of the largest dealerships in the country, sponsors the show. It hosts RV shows throughout the year, with the Fairplex show being the largest. More than 350 new and used recreational vehicles will be on display with all brands represented, including Monaco, Fleetwood, National, Weekend Warrior, Thor and more.
Lenders and banks will have representatives at the show for instant financing. Every coach will be discounted and prices and monthly payments clearly marked to provide a no-hassle shopping experience.
